MONDAY 10 p.m. on NGEO Clotilda: Last American Slave Ship

New documentar­y explores the 2019 discovery of the wreckage of the Clotilda, the last known ship used to transport enslaved Africans into Mobile, Ala., in 1860, long after that practice was banned by Congress.
